发表评论取消回复
相关阅读
相关 如何确保main主函数在其他线程运行完了之后再执行结束语句
如果要在其他线程运行完之后再执行main函数的结束语句,可以使用如下方法: 1. 使用线程的join()方法。在创建线程时,可以调用线程的join()方法,这样主线程就会等
相关 【引用】如何结束线程运行(转)
在一些应用程序中,除非用户去结束应用程序的运行,否则其中的子线程会一直处于运行状态。如果应用程序在结束时不主动通知子线程退出,有可能导致主线程结束后,子线程的系统资源得不到释放
相关 在Java中如何确保在多线程情况下,所有线程都完成再继续执行任务?
1.使用awaitTermination awaitTermination是executorService自带的方法,用来确保所有的线程任务都执行完毕。 例如下使用线程
相关 多线程所有子线程执行完后再执行主线程,子线程并行执行
多线程所有子线程执行完后再执行主线程。 方法一: 使用CountDownLatch 计数器 public static void main(String[]
相关 main线程终止,其他线程还会运行吗?
main线程终止,其他线程还会运行吗? 01 理论分析 当你启动一个Java Application的时候,这个时候系统创建一个进程,分配各项资源,然后这个
相关 前端多个异步函数执行完成之后再执行其他的程序
需求描述 有多个异步函数都执行完成之后,才能执行其他的代码,可以使用Promise.all() 方法: let P1 = new Promise(functio
相关 如何确保三个线程顺序执行
场景:有三个线程t1、t2、t3。确保三个线程t1执行完后t2执行,t2执行完成后t3执行。 1、thread.Join把指定的线程加入到当前线程,可以将两个交替执行的
相关 面试官:如何让主线程等待所有的子线程执行结束之后再执行?我懵了
使用Thread的join方法 package com.qcy.testThreadFinish; / @author qcy
相关 c++中main函数执行完之后还能执行其他程序吗?
![在这里插入图片描述][20200811211306156.png] 程序退出的方式: mian()函数执行结束、在程序某个地方使用exit()结束程序、用户可以通过ct
相关 如何确保三个线程顺序执行?
场景:有三个线程t1、t2、t3。确保三个线程t1执行完后t2执行,t2执行完成后t3执行。 1.使用join thread.Join把指定的线程加入到
还没有评论,来说两句吧...